Hand Hygiene - Dalco Online

For information specific to healthcare, see CDC’s Hand Hygiene in Healthcare. Handwashing CDC Printout. Wet your hands with clean, running water (warm or cold), turn off the tap and apply soap. Lather your hands by rubbing them together with the soap. Be sure to lather the backs of your hands, between your fingers, and under your nails.

What is Hand Hygiene?

Indications for Hand Hygiene. Use an alcohol based hand rub for all clinical situations where hands are visibly clean. Wash with soap and water when visibly dirty or contaminated with proteinaceous material, or visibly soiled with blood or other body fluids, or if exposure to potential spore forming organisms is strongly suspected or proven, or after using the bathroom.

When and How to Wash Your Hands | Handwashing | CDC

Washing hands with soap and water is the best way to get rid of germs in most situations. If soap and water are not readily available, you can use an alcohol-based hand sanitizer that contains at least 60% alcohol. You can tell if the sanitizer contains at least 60% alcohol by looking at the product label.
